The first and second seasons of Netflix’s Stranger Things were released in consecutive years, with the first season releasing in 2016, followed by season two in 2017. Unfortunately season three skipped 2018, where Netflix later confirmed that it would instead be released in 2019, but when exactly?

For those who have been anticipating the release of season three, you’ll be very pleased to learn that Netflix has since confirmed that Stranger Things will be returning to their platform on the 4th of July, 2019. Given that the 4th of July is also Independence Day and is a public holiday in the US, it means that those who are living in the US will be able to binge watch the entire season on the day itself, assuming you have nothing else to do.

Most (if not all) of the cast from the previous season will be returning to reprise their roles.
